Android embedded engineer, R&D (Leading gaming company, Up to $80k)
What You'll Do
AOSP Engineering Track
Scout, evaluate, and document emerging hardware technologies to build team knowledge and capability.
Source, set up, and assess developer kits; engage with vendors to unlock technical depth.
Analysis field problems seeking both immediate and ultimate improvements.
Design and run experiments for reliability, performance, thermals, power, camera optics, and latency; analyze and present results.
Prototype novel architectures and features to demonstrate feasibility and inform product decisions.
Develop, adapt, and optimize low level drivers, HALs, and firmware.
Contribute to accessories, motion tracking technologies, and the Playground OS.
Contribute to the requirements and architecture for future hardware.
Provide technical guidance on hardware strategy, risks, and trade offs.
R&D Track
Bring up new platforms and hardware, and optimize Playground’s AOSP-based OS across SoC, GPU, NPU, Camera, ISP, WiFi, Bluetooth, HDMI, and power for best-in-class performance.
Design and implement system APIs, HAL, and framework layers in close partnership with the app, game, and CV/ML teams.
Tune state-of-the-art image processing, CV, and ML pipelines to run efficiently on-device.
Own system security end-to-end — harden the boot and verification chain, manage keys, and keep security patches current.
Profile and debug deep into the stack with tools like perfetto, systrace, tcpdump, and Arm Mobile Studio, and drive field issues to root cause.
Partner with SoC vendors and ODM / JDM partners on BSP drops, escalations, and silicon-level issues.
Support manufacturing and factory operations — device provisioning, calibration data, key storage, and factory test images.
Must Have
Bachelor's degree in Computer Science, Electrical/Electronic Engineering, or related field.
A strong track record of building embedded systems / personal devices / home entertainment devices on Android (AOSP).
Deep knowledge of Android/Linux internals, drivers, HALs, system debugging, and performance optimization.
Proficiency in C, C++, Python, Java, Node,js or Golang.
Excellent communication in English and Mandarin Chinese.
Employer questions
- Which of the following statements best describes your right to work in Hong Kong?
- What's your expected monthly basic salary?
- How many years' experience do you have as an Embedded Engineer?
- How many years of Android development experience do you have?
- Which of the following programming languages are you experienced in?
- Which of the following languages are you fluent in?
Report this job advert
- Role descriptions
- Salary insights
- Tools to help you prepare for jobs